Responsibilities:
- Discover GrubHub's next wave of great local restaurants: We need you to engage the most wanted restaurants in your territory and help us discover those hidden gems our diners are craving
- Consult with restaurant owners on the benefits of joining GrubHub and having access to our rapidly growing community of hungry diners. Identify needs and goals of the restaurant and demonstrate how GrubHub can help grow their business
- Conduct extensive cold calling (60+ dials per day), emailing, and social outreach to prospective decision makers
- Exceed high-volume sales goals while working within a team environment
- Be the market expert: gather restaurant feedback, monitor competitor activity, marketing opportunities, and provide recommendations for improvement to management
